RCOM gains on inking pact with Tata Teleservices

23 Jul 2013 Evaluate

Reliance Communications is currently trading at Rs 141.80, up by 0.55 points or 0.39% from its previous closing of Rs. 141.25 on the BSE.

The scrip opened at Rs 142.55 and has touched a high and low of Rs 143.25 and Rs 140.65 respectively. So far 616064 shares were traded on the counter.

The BSE group 'A' stock of face value Rs 5 has touched a 52 week high of Rs 151.25 on 17-Jul-2013 and a 52 week low of Rs 46.60 on 30-Aug-2012.

Last one week high and low of the scrip stood at Rs 151.25 and Rs 136.10 respectively. The current market cap of the company is Rs 29102.78 crore.

The promoters holding in the company stood at 67.86% while Institutions and Non-Institutions held 19.68% and 12.17% respectively.

Reliance Communications (RCOM) inked pact with Tata Teleservices (TTSL) under a 2G intra-circle roaming arrangement, with aims to cut costs and boost network coverage. As per the deal RCOM will utilize 5,000 towers of TTSL across 14 GSM circles while TTSL will gain access to an equal number of towers in RCOM's CDMA network to improve its reach.

With this initiative, RCOM will have access to networks of Aircel, Loop and TTSL across the country, increasing its network coverage by an additional 10,000 towers. Reliance Communications currently has over 45,000 towers of its own.
